kill对应的是PID,pkill对应的是command
pgrep -l mycmd
注意命令名称过长pkill匹配进程名称是有可能被截取。
pkill -9 '^pu_simulatio(n$|nW|nD)'
匹配pu_simulation , pu_simulationW.* pu_simulationD.*
pkill支持regexp
pkill -9 '^mycmd$'
补充:
pkill -f 可以避免名称被截断问题?